Article Overview

Installing an industrial back distribution box requires careful site preparation, proper mounting, correct wiring, and thorough testing to ensure safety and compliance.

Site Preparation

Before installation, survey the installation site to ensure it is dry, well-ventilated, and free from flammable, corrosive, or explosive materials . Determine the load requirements and select a distribution box with the appropriate size, model, and IP/NEMA rating for industrial conditions, such as IP66 or IP67 for outdoor or harsh environments . Ensure sufficient working space around the box for maintenance and future upgrades.

Mounting the Box

Use sturdy mounting brackets or expansion bolts to secure the box to a wall or panel . The box should be level, stable, and at an accessible height (typically around 1.5 meters) to allow easy operation of breakers and fuses . For outdoor installations, consider a waterproof enclosure and rain cover to prevent water ingress . Maintain manufacturer-recommended clearances and ensure hinged doors can open fully without obstruction.

Wiring and Connections

  1. Turn off the main power supply and verify with a voltage tester. Place a warning sign to prevent accidental energizing .
  2. Strip wires to the correct length and connect them to terminals according to standard color codes: brown (live), blue (neutral), green/yellow (earth), .
  3. Secure grounding and ensure proper insulation. Use cable ties or conduits to organize wires neatly and leave space for heat dissipation .
  4. Install protection devices such as MCBs, fuses, and surge protectors for each circuit .

Testing and Commissioning

After wiring, perform insulation resistance tests to verify proper insulation between wires and the box . Use a multimeter to check the on/off status of each circuit and ensure there are no short circuits or broken connections . Document all installation details for future inspections and maintenance.

Safety and Maintenance

Operators should wear personal protective equipment including insulating gloves, safety glasses, and slip-resistant shoes . Schedule regular inspections and maintenance to ensure long-term reliability, and label all circuits clearly for easy identification . Consider modular designs to facilitate future upgrades or expansions. By following these steps, you can ensure that your industrial back distribution box is installed safely, efficiently, and in compliance with relevant electrical standards .
